Cost Details for Hotel Building Takeoff Estimate
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Construction Materials | $325,000 – $780,000 |
Labor | $156,000 – $377,000 |
Equipment Rental | $39,000 – $97,500 |
Miscellaneous | $19,500 – $52,000 |
Total Estimated Cost | $539,500 – $1,306,500 |
When estimating the costs for a hotel building, several factors are considered such as the size of the building, the quality of materials desired, and the level of finishing. For instance, a mid-sized hotel with approximately 100 rooms might require construction materials ranging from $325,000 to $780,000. This includes materials such as bricks, concrete, steel, and roofing materials. Labor costs could vary from $156,000 to $377,000 depending on the complexity of the project and prevailing wages in the area. It covers expenses related to skilled and unskilled labor, including construction workers, supervisors, and engineers. Equipment rental costs for heavy machinery, cranes, and tools are estimated to range from $39,000 to $97,500. Miscellaneous expenses, including permits, inspections, and contingency funds, are estimated between $19,500 to $52,000.

Cost Details for Hospital Building Takeoff Estimate
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Construction Materials | $780,000 – $1,950,000 |
Specialized Equipment | $325,000 – $780,000 |
Infrastructure | $260,000 – $650,000 |
Safety Measures | $130,000 – $325,000 |
Total Estimated Cost | $1,495,000 – $3,705,000 |
Building a hospital involves significant expenses due to the specialized nature of the facility. Construction materials alone can cost between $780,000 and $1,950,000 for a mid-sized hospital with various departments. This includes high-quality materials such as specialized flooring, medical-grade paints, and durable fixtures. Specialized equipment such as medical imaging machines, surgical instruments, and patient beds can add an additional $325,000 to $780,000 to the total cost. Infrastructure costs, including HVAC systems, plumbing, and electrical work, typically range from $260,000 to $650,000. This encompasses the installation of advanced medical systems, emergency power generators, and data networking infrastructure. Safety measures, including fire suppression systems, security systems, and ADA compliance, are estimated between $130,000 to $325,000.

Cost Details for Multi-Family Building Takeoff Estimate
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Construction Materials | $390,000 – $975,000 |
Labor | $195,000 – $487,500 |
Site Preparation | $65,000 – $162,500 |
Finishing | $130,000 – $325,000 |
Total Estimated Cost | $780,000 – $1,950,000 |
When estimating the costs for a multi-family building, factors such as the number of units, building size, and quality of finishes are considered. For example, a multi-family building with 20 units might require construction materials ranging from $390,000 to $975,000. This includes materials such as concrete, lumber, roofing, and finishes for kitchens and bathrooms. Labor costs could vary from $195,000 to $487,500 depending on the complexity of the project and local labor rates. This covers expenses related to skilled and unskilled labor, including construction workers, supervisors, and subcontractors. Site preparation costs, including excavation, grading, and utility connections, are estimated between $65,000 to $162,500. Finishing costs, including painting, flooring, and landscaping, are estimated between $130,000 to $325,000.

Cost Details for Warehouse Takeoff Estimate
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Construction Materials | $260,000 – $650,000 |
Storage Systems | $130,000 – $325,000 |
Lighting | $65,000 – $162,500 |
Safety Features | $32,500 – $78,000 |
Total Estimated Cost | $487,500 – $1,215,500 |
The cost of constructing a warehouse depends on factors such as the size of the building, the type of materials used, and the complexity of the storage systems. For instance, a warehouse with 50,000 square feet of space might require construction materials ranging from $260,000 to $650,000. This includes materials such as steel framing, concrete flooring, and metal roofing. Storage systems, including shelving, racks, and pallets, could cost an additional $130,000 to $325,000. Lighting costs, including fixtures and installation, are estimated between $65,000 to $162,500. Safety features, including fire suppression systems, security cameras, and access control systems, are estimated between $32,500 to $78,000.

Cost Details for School Building Takeoff Estimate
Component | Estimated Cost (USD) |
Construction Materials | $520,000 – $1,300,000 |
Classroom Equipment | $195,000 – $487,500 |
Furniture | $97,500 – $240,500 |
Safety Features | $65,000 – $162,500 |
Total Estimated Cost | $877,500 – $2,190,500 |
The cost of constructing a school building varies based on factors such as the size of the facility, the number of classrooms, and the quality of materials and equipment. For example, a school building with 20 classrooms might require construction materials ranging from $520,000 to $1,300,000. This includes materials such as concrete, bricks, roofing, and flooring materials suitable for educational environments. Classroom equipment costs, including desks, chairs, whiteboards, and AV systems, could range from $195,000 to $487,500. Furniture costs, including office furniture, cafeteria tables, and library shelving, are estimated between $97,500 to $240,500. Safety features such as fire alarms, emergency exits, and security systems are estimated between $65,000 to $162,500.
